DANIEL J. MCLEOD v. LOUISE M. MACUL
Reporter of Decisions
ERRATA SHEET
The opinion of this Court certified on May 26, 2016, and corrected on June 2, 2016, is further corrected as follows:
The second sentence of paragraph 11 is corrected to read,
These findings are directed to Macul's testimony that she had a former career in hospital administration, a field she has not worked in since the 1990s; was trained as an English language teacher; held the unpaid position of executive director of an nongovernmental organization/nonprofit museum in Malaysia; and has not been paid any income from employment since 1999.
The corrected opinion on the Judicial Branch website has been replaced with the opinion as further corrected.
